Surf Club - Tesla Destination
Surf Club - Tesla Destination is an EV charging station located at 9011 Collins Avenue, Surfside, Florida. It offers 3 charging ports on the Tesla Destination network.
Surf Club - Tesla Destination is an EV charging station in Surfside, Florida on the Tesla Destination network. It has 3 charging ports (3 Level 2 ports) with charging speeds up to 3.7 kW.
